Professor Yu Chen is a Principal Investigator and Professor at Wuhan University's College of Life Sciences, leading research at the State Key Laboratory of Virology since December 2016. With a PhD in Microbiology from Wuhan University (2003-2009), Dr. Chen has established a prominent research program focused on RNA virus molecular mechanisms, particularly coronaviruses.
Research interests center on viral RNA methylation processes, coronavirus replication strategies, and host-pathogen interactions. The lab investigates SARS-CoV-2 variants, viral entry mechanisms through ACE2 receptors, and development of broad-spectrum antivirals targeting RNA modification enzymes. Recent work examines interferon signaling pathways and adenovirus-related pediatric hepatitis.
